Gasoline Engine G.04 VTOL Fixed-Wing Heavy-Lift Gasoline UAV 3557mm Wingspan 79.6kg Payload 4291m Ceiling

G.04 Heavy-Lift Gasoline UAV

The G.04 is a high-performance gasoline engine-powered VTOL fixed-wing unmanned aerial vehicle, engineered for Disaster Relief. Featuring a 3557mm wingspan and 79.6kg payload capacity, this UAV delivers exceptional 376-minute endurance and 1438km operational range. The entire airframe is constructed from aviation-grade carbon fiber composite, ensuring an optimal balance of structural strength and lightweight portability.

Equipped with an advanced flight control system and modular payload architecture, the G.04 supports rapid mission reconfiguration. Its VTOL capability eliminates the need for runways, enabling deployment from confined spaces. The IPX4 protection rating ensures reliable operation in challenging environmental conditions.

Key Features

  • Advanced VTOL Capability – Vertical takeoff and landing without runway infrastructure, deployable from ships, rooftops, or compact terrain
  • Full Carbon Fiber Airframe – Aerospace-grade composite construction for 66.1kg lightweight design with industry-leading strength-to-weight ratio
  • Gasoline Engine Power System – Optimized for 376min continuous flight with efficient fuel/energy management and redundant safety protocols
  • 79.6kg Payload Capacity – Modular bay accommodates EO/IR cameras, LiDAR, SAR radar, communication relays, and custom mission equipment
  • 1438km Operational Range – Beyond-line-of-sight capability with secure datalink and autonomous return-to-home fail-safe
  • IPX4 Environmental Protection – Reliable operation in rain, dust, and extreme temperatures from -20°C to 50°C

FAQ

What missions is the G.04 best suited for?

The G.04 is optimized for Disaster Relief operations, with its 79.6kg payload and 1438km range making it ideal for extended-duration missions requiring reliable beyond-line-of-sight communication.

Can the payload configuration be customized?

Yes, the modular payload bay supports rapid swapping between EO/IR gimbals, LiDAR scanners, multispectral cameras, SAR systems, and communication relay equipment based on mission requirements.

How does the VTOL transition work?

The G.04 uses a seamless transition flight controller that automatically manages the conversion from vertical hover to fixed-wing cruise flight, requiring no manual pilot intervention during transition.

What training is required to operate this UAV?

Basic operator training typically takes 3-5 days, covering mission planning, pre-flight checks, emergency procedures, and data post-processing. Advanced payload operation training is available separately.
